A Truth Revealed
in a Dream
in a Dream
This elegy
for oaks is early
But the way
of the world
Is that
Griffin Woods will be sold,
The ancient
trees sawed down,
The land
stripped for a strip mall.
Acorns will
rot under asphalt
And whose
fault is it?
Clearly, the
trees.
They don’t
pay taxes.
Lola Lucas
